Ethereum
Block
21403107
0x26dc5d39bd7a8bc2d792dcaaac55fe6dcef25593
EOA
Active on
Ethereum with -- and
1,757 txns
Funded by
0x5f56
…
716b
via
0x65b5
…
fc3e
First active
2 years ago
Last active
2 years ago
Loading...